Rømø: A Danish Island Paradise
Rømø offers visitors a unique blend of natural beauty and historical significance. From the vast sandy beaches perfect for beachcombing and kite flying, to the picturesque Rømø Harbor where you can watch fishing boats come and go, there is something for everyone to enjoy. Explore the Rømø Church, a historic building dating back to the 13th century, or visit the Rømø Museum to learn about the island's rich maritime history. For adventurous souls, the Rømø Kite Festival is a must-see event, showcasing colorful kites of all shapes and sizes filling the sky. Whether you are seeking relaxation or excitement, Rømø has it all.
